Excit­ing insights into mod­ern trans­port tech­nolo­gies - Com­puter sci­ence stu­dents visit SWARCO

On October 23, students from the University of Innsbruck participated in an exclusive SWARCO Bootcamp at the company's headquarters in Wattens.

Around 15 students, together with postdocs from the Department of Computer Science, gained in-depth insights into current developments in modern transportation technologies.

Following a presentation of the company's history – from the first glass particles in road markings to Intelligent Transport Systems (ITS) and Connected, Cooperative and Automated Mobility (CCAM) – SWARCO experts presented current research and development projects. The focus was particularly on AI-supported methods for automating imaging processes in road traffic.

The students developed their own ideas and concepts for future mobility solutions in subsequent group work sessions. The bootcamp thus offered not only valuable insights from a technical perspective, but also an excellent opportunity for networking between university and industry.

The SWARCO AG is also a member of the consortium of the AIM AT Endowed professorship for Edge AI.
